Output 583bbf8cfd73846b31efefcbd2dba566b33f5edea4e87f2d911141516793f248:18

value
1377229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2d10a1cb04d824a42d721b4262863e2f644b606 OP_EQUAL
address
3LuiF9VbWvd4mbuMdnqhj9JdD1zfqYwF45
transaction
583bbf8cfd73846b31efefcbd2dba566b33f5edea4e87f2d911141516793f248
confirmations
20321
spent
true